Go to map
Plaza De La Encarnacion, 19, Seville, Spain (Open map)
Plaza De La Magdalena 1, Seville, Spain (Open map)
8 Avenida De La Constitucion, Seville, Spain (Open map)
Calle Fernandez Y Gonzalez 4, Seville, Spain (Open map)
24 Calle Calatrava, Seville, Spain (Open map)
Plaza De Molviedro 4, Seville, Spain (Open map)
Avenida De La Buhaira 2, Seville, Spain (Open map)
Juan Mata Carriazo, 7, Seville, Spain (Open map)